Patients older than 18 years, with good general health, acceptable oral hygiene,
with return periods of availability in the evaluation and who have at least 5 teeth with non carious cervical lesions - NCCLs; The teeth with lesions should have a normal occlusal relationship with the antagonist, not present prior restorative treatment; The wells should not be latched with minimum depth of 0.5 mm and mesiodistal width minimum of 1 mm.
Patients who have dental caries, periodontal problems, dry mouth, bruxism. Pregnant; breastfeeding; patients who are undergoing orthodontic treatment; teeth with sharp occlusal stress.
